华盛顿,宾夕法尼亚州(10月. 23, 2020) – When COVID-19 altered Erik Blasic’s summer plans to complete an internship, he decided to make an opportunity of his own.

今年,华盛顿 & 杰佛逊学院&J) history major and economics minor became the second W&J history student to earn the Gordon E. Swartz History 奖学金 to fund his work. 最初, 他打算用这5美元,000 award to supplement his summer internship but found himself instead planning an independent research project inspired by an economics project he began in Dr. 罗伯•邓恩’s Econometrics class this past spring. Erik decided to take the idea of a statistical economic analysis and marry it with his passion for history, 由另一个W提示&J class he took – War and Society with Dr. 大卫·基兰, examining the culture around war. Erik set out to research the cross-section of military and civilian life and study statistical significance in Army recruitment.

“The volunteer Army that we have now has this bad rap that we think that lower income individuals go into the military because they don’t have any other options. I looked into that to see if it was true,埃里克说, noting that this research showed that the Army has moved into a middle-class classification. He noticed another trend, though.

“What I did find out is the data showed that Army recruiting—and not just Army, 还有海军, Marines, and Air Force—disproportionately takes place in the regional south compared to other U.S. regions. The southern states are over-represented as military recruits over any other region,” he said.

Erik’s project now is to ask why. Using the Swartz 奖学金 funds, he was able to access ArcGIS software, allowing him to map Army recruitment by examining the density population of active army members, 退伍军人, and base locations on separate and overlaying maps. The maps showed that all three are more common in the south.

“The familiarity is a common factor of why the south is overrepresented,埃里克说. “If you know someone in your family has served, you’re more likely to serve yourself. So, if there are more 退伍军人 in the south, it makes sense that more recruits join.”

Erik is including this and other findings in a research paper he’s compiling with Dr. Kieran in an independent study course that will serve as his Capstone project as he prepares to graduate this December.
